WebMethod 3: Again, suppose that x y = y for all real y. Put another way, x y − y = 0 for all real y, or by factoring, ( x − 1) y = 0 for all real y. Now, the only way two real numbers can have a product of 0 is if at least one of the numbers is 0, so we know that x − 1 = 0 or y = 0. ( Note: This includes the possibility that both are 0.) WebThe natural numbers are, of course, also called the counting numbers. Any time we enumerate the members of a team, count the coins in a collection, or tally the trees in a grove, we are using the set of natural numbers. The set of whole numbers is the set of natural numbers and zero: [latex]\{0, 1, 2, 3,…\}[/latex].
